Font Size: a A A

Thricotomy Testing Method Of Visual Modeling Tools

Posted on:2006-09-20Degree:MasterType:Thesis
Country:ChinaCandidate:C L WangFull Text:PDF
GTID:2168360155466832Subject:Computer software and theory
Abstract/Summary:PDF Full Text Request
Software test is executing process in order to find mistake. It is important part in software engineering, while software development. In other word, the software tested and testified can ensure and validate quality. And in software engineering, software test is only effective method for validating software design to accord with expect target.Software test has been tens years while the concept of software engineering. In course of, going with software development method, the method of test software has been developing and going up. Whiling it, software test has been divided into many study fields, conventional test methods, object-oriented test method, oriented web application test method, e.g. But a kind of test method orients development method.Recently, based on object-oriented software modeling method has become a study respect in scholars. Overseas Co. Rational have developed Rational Rose tool's software holding out UML. Internal research institution e.g. Beijing University of Aeronautics &Astronautics software graduate school's UML-Designer and Peking University computer department's JBOO3.0. Into the bargain, our lab independence developed sustaining user interface automatic make AUI based on visual modeling.By this narrate, we can know, the activity developing sustaining modeling tools has been expanding, also modeling method. So software test is importance work for validating quality. But these test methods aren't in suit with testing visual modeling software now, for characteristics on modeling tools. E.g.import specifically, the import is the model built for demand; export specifically, the export is program code for model; multidimensional affect of program modification, e.g. program design, amending modeling method. And it is the most importance peculiarity that instance testing is in order for verify and validate modeling method's correctness and sufficiency. Thinking of these instances, this paper put forward a TRICHOTOMY TESTING METHOD for visual modeling software.The main work of this paper includes following.? Literature summarizing. It found that test method is not suit of sustaining visual modeling tools by referring literature. In traditional test, white box method verifies structure; black box method tests software designed function. It is important testing content for testing class and class cluster in object-oriented test. For Web application test, testing importance orients net application. For GUI testing, it tests user interface widget mostly.? Proposing TRICHOTOMY TESTING METHOD. It included, first, the theory of modeling software division for model check and GUI testing and the function sustaining modeling, the representation is definition, second, propose whole test process, and embodied it, third, the paper give test analyzing report template, and propose test matter and test principle for modeling software.? Summarizing a mass of result of instance test. It tested AUI in function modeling, object modeling, interaction modeling, user interface template, by beyond 200 user interface instance test from command modeling at AUI to creating code, the paper gave AUI colligation test evaluation via trichotomy testing method. In other side, paper give validity of this method via test AUI based on the method.
Keywords/Search Tags:Software test, Trichotomy testing method, Modeling method, UML, GUI, Object-Oriented, Software Engineering
PDF Full Text Request
Related items